- [ ] **Step 7: Breaker override escrow.** After sealing the signing keys for the Tallgrove upstream API circuit breaker, confirm the support team can force the breaker open during a full outage. The override bundle lives in the sealed escrow drawer and is useless without its unlock phrase. Two ceremony witnesses must initial this step before proceeding. The escrow bundle is decrypted with the recovery passphrase that follows.

vault phrase of kahip-kahop = holath-quenmir

Step 6: Wiring up the Stormfeed fan-out. This is the bit that pushes weather alerts from the ingest queue out to every regional relay, so don't skip the dry run — fire a test alert at the staging relays first and confirm all of them ack within five seconds. If one lags, check its subscription filter before blaming the network. Once staging looks clean, you're ready to sign the fan-out config for production. Sign it with the deploy key below.

rollout seal: bky9_PeXH1fTLY

**Q: A customer's custom validator plugin stopped loading after the Castellan 3.2 upgrade. What do I tell them?**

A: Version 3.2 enforces signed plugin manifests. Unsigned plugins are skipped with a warning in the loader log, not an error. Ask the customer to re-sign using the bundled signing tool and restart the service. Legacy unsigned mode was removed and will not return. For signing problems beyond that, have them contact the plugins desk.

escalation mailbox, bafog-fafog: ulador@paliqlabs.internal